fare-paying

English

Adjective

fare-paying (not comparable)

  1. Relating to people who pay a fare for a journey, usually on public transport.
    • 2020 July 1, “Network News: ORR authorises GA Class 720/5s to carry passengers”, in Rail, page 12:
      All 111 trains (89 five-car and 22 ten-car sets) were due in traffic by now, but so far none has carried a fare-paying passenger.
